Practical Applications in Agricultural Management

One of the most compelling applications of hydrological data is in agricultural management. A key case study involves the use of real-time water level monitoring in irrigation systems. By collecting and interpreting hydrological data, farmers can optimize water usage, reduce waste, and improve crop yield. For instance, in California's Central Valley, where water resources are critically managed, farmers use sensors to monitor soil moisture and adjust irrigation schedules accordingly. This not only conserves water but also ensures that crops receive the optimal amount of water, leading to higher productivity and sustainability.

Environmental Monitoring and Management

Environmental monitoring is another critical area where hydrological data plays a vital role. The certificate teaches you how to collect data on parameters such as pH, dissolved oxygen, and nutrient levels to assess water quality. A real-world example is the monitoring of rivers and lakes affected by industrial discharges. In the case of the Danube River, environmental agencies use hydrological data to track pollutants and ensure compliance with environmental regulations. By analyzing the data, they can identify pollution sources and implement corrective measures to protect aquatic ecosystems.

Disaster Risk Reduction and Water Management

Disasters such as floods and droughts are significant challenges in many parts of the world. A Professional Certificate in Hydrological Data Collection & Interpretation equips you with the tools to mitigate these risks. For example, during the 2010 floods in Pakistan, hydrological data were crucial for predicting flood patterns and implementing early warning systems. By collecting data on rainfall, snowmelt, and river flow, hydrologists could forecast potential flooding and alert communities, potentially saving lives and reducing damage.
